The final price for impact windows depends on several variables. The biggest factor is the size and type of your window frames, along with the specific glass thickness required for your local building codes. Opting for custom shapes or specialized tints also shifts the total. An impact window is a window constructed to withstand high winds and flying debris, crucial for areas prone to severe weather. They feature a strong frame and laminated glass, which is made of two panes bonded with a special plastic interlayer. This design prevents the glass from shattering into dangerous pieces, offering enhanced security and protection for your Glendale home.
For Glendale homeowners, the initial cost of impact windows is typically higher than standard windows. Some may also find them to be heavier, which could affect installation or ease of operation. However, the considerable benefits of enhanced protection against severe weather and potential long-term savings often make these drawbacks less significant.
The 'highest rated' impact window is generally determined by its performance in stringent testing, such as meeting Miami-Dade County standards for wind and impact resistance.
